Jeep Tj Heater Control Problem: Diagnostics, Causes, and Fixes

The Jeep TJ (1997–2006) heater system is a common source of annoyance for owners who notice inconsistent cabin warmth, stale airflow, or unexpected HVAC temperatures. A heater control problem can stem from mechanical blend doors, faulty actuators, a stuck or failing heater control valve, wiring issues, or a weak thermostat. Common Symptoms Of A Jeep Tj Heater Control Problem

Recognizing specific symptoms can guide diagnostics. When the heater control is failing, one may notice: uneven or no heat from the vents regardless of temperature setting, temperature fluctuating with engine RPM, blend door movement sounds (clunking or clicking) from under the dash, persistent cold air at all settings, or a stuck vacuum or electric actuator failing to respond to control inputs. In some cases, the pedal-to-heat linkage or dashboard controls may feel loose or unresponsive. Awareness of these signs helps pinpoint whether the problem lies with the HVAC control head, blend doors, valves, or electrical connections.

Key Components Behind The Jeep Tj Heater System

The TJ heater system comprises several intertwined parts. The heater control valve regulates coolant flow to the heater core, influencing heat output. Blend doors within the HVAC plenum determine the mix of hot and cold air. Actuators or vacuum motors move these doors in response to the climate control inputs. The control head on the dash interprets user settings and sends signals to actuators. A failing thermostat can also limit heat supply by preventing the engine from reaching operating temperature. Understanding these components clarifies which part to inspect first when diagnosing a heater control problem.

Diagnosing The Problem: A Step-By-Step Approach

Begin with safe, systematic checks. First, verify engine temperature is normal; a stuck thermostat can masquerade as a heater issue. Next, observe whether the heater core receives warm coolant by feeling the upper radiator hose when the engine reaches operating temperature. If heat is present but inconsistent, the blend door or its actuator is a likely culprit. Inspect the heater control valve for proper operation; some TJ models use vacuum actuators controlled by the dash vacuum supply, which can be compromised by leaks. Use a vacuum gauge or spray soapy water to check for leaks along vacuum lines. If the control head responds inconsistently, electrical or wiring problems may exist, including blown fuses, corroded connectors, or faulty ground paths. Document symptoms and test each component in isolation when possible to avoid conflating issues.

Do-It-Yourself Fixes And Replacement Tips

For many Jeep TJ owners, the most practical fixes target the blend door actuator, heater control valve, and vacuum lines. If a noisy or sluggish blend door is suspected, remove the center console or lower dash panel to access the actuator. In some cases, lubrication or light replacement of the actuator resolves intermittent movement. A vacuum-operated blend door actuator should have a solid, tidy vacuum line without cracks; replace any compromised hoses and ensure the vacuum source is stable when the engine is running. If the heater control valve is stuck or leaking, replace it with an OEM or reputable aftermarket valve designed for the TJ’s coolant flow. When replacing a valve, ensure any heater hoses are clamped securely and heater core flow is unobstructed. Replacing the HVAC control head may be necessary if all temperatures respond unpredictably to settings; seek a unit with compatible wiring and climate control functions for the specific TJ year and trim. Always depressurize cooling system before work on hoses to avoid scalding.

Electrical And Vacuum Troubleshooting

Electrical issues can mimic mechanical failures. Check fuses related to the HVAC system and ensure a solid ground connection at the body and engine grounds. Inspect wiring harnesses behind the dash for wear or pinched insulation, especially where the control head plugs into the HVAC module. For vacuum-driven systems, confirm that vacuum supply lines to the actuator are intact and not blocked by debris; leaks can cause the actuator to fail to move the blend doors. If the problem centers on the control head, perform a functional test or swap in a known-good unit to verify operation. In all cases, clear, labeled connections make future diagnostics easier and safer.

When To Replace Versus Repair

Repair is often feasible for worn vacuum hoses, a faulty evaporator temperature sensor, or a sluggish blend door actuator. Replacement becomes sensible when the actuator is intermittently failing, vacuum lines show persistent cracks, the heater control valve leaks, or the HVAC control head no longer responds reliably to user input. Replacement should use parts rated for the TJ model year and configuration. Consider upgrading to a modern rebuilt control head if original equipment becomes scarce. Always verify that new parts meet OEM specifications for compatibility with the Jeep TJ’s cooling and HVAC systems to avoid future failures.

Preventive Maintenance And Longevity Tips

Preventive steps can extend the life of the heater system. Regularly inspect heater hoses for cracking or hardening, and replace aging hoses before leaks occur. Periodically check vacuum lines for stiffness or damage, replacing any soft or leaking segments. Monitor engine cooling performance; an overworked or underperforming cooling system affects heater output. Ensure the thermostat operates correctly to prevent delayed heating. When performing other maintenance, visually inspect the HVAC components behind the dash for signs of wear, and address any module or wire corrosion promptly. A proactive approach reduces the likelihood of sudden heater control problems and keeps cabin comfort consistent for TJ owners.
